Kerala reports over 30,000 cases for 3rd consecutive day; TPR at 19.22%

Kerala continued to report over 30,000 cases for the third consecutive day on Friday and showed an increased Test Positivity Rate, while 179 deaths took the the toll to 20,313. The state logged 32,801 cases today, up from 30,007 on Thursday.

In effort to save people from Covid-19, we kill them by fire: Supreme Court slams Gujarat government

The Supreme Court on Friday slammed the Gujarat government for relaxing building norms for hospitals, saying that in the effort of saving people from the Covid-19 pandemic, it was killing them by fire.

Covid-19 Vaccine Matters: All eyes on Zydus Cadila's shot rollout for children as fear of third wave looms large

This week India crossed a major milestone of inoculating half of its target population with at least one dose of the Covid-19 vaccine, which may help in tackling the third wave of the pandemic as and when it comes. Nearly 99 per cent of healthcare workers and 100 per cent of frontline workers received the first dose, according to Union Health Secretary Rajesh Bhushan.

Covid-19 bigger blood clot threat than vaccines, UK study finds

A coronavirus infection presents a much higher risk of developing a blood clot than the first dose of either the Oxford/AstraZeneca or the Pfizer/BioNTech jab, a large study led by the University of Oxford said on Friday.

100,000 more Covid deaths seen unless US changes its ways

The USis projected to see nearly 100,000 more Covid-19 deaths between now and December1, according to the nation's most closely watched forecasting model. But health experts say that toll could be cut in half if nearly everyone wore a mask in public spaces.

In other words, what the coronavirus has in store this fall depends on human behavior.

Contaminant in Moderna vaccines suspected to be metallic powder

The contaminant found in a Japan-bound lot of Moderna Inc's Covid-19 vaccines is suspected to be a metallic powder, Japanese public broadcaster NHK reported, citing sources at the health ministry.
